Handover note — from Director Tam Welling to Director Iris Corbeau, for the finance team. Next year's training budget stands at the figure agreed in October, split 60/40 between technical certification and leadership courses. Unspent funds from the Merrow programme roll forward automatically. Invoices route through the shared cost centre as before; approvals above threshold need both our signatures until the transition completes. One confidential planning point is appended below this note.

management briefing: Only 5 of the 80 pilot accounts renewed Zorix, so a churn review is set for October 1.

**Ticket: Config drift on picklist optimizer**

The Sortwise optimizer in the Bramfield warehouse is running different bin-weighting settings than the repo says it should. Someone hand-edited prod weeks ago and never committed. Do not change anything yet — first document what's actually deployed. The values currently live on the prod host are as follows.

settings of fafog-haduf:
ZORIX_PIN=4648
ZORIX_METRICS_HOST=metrics.zorix.paliqsys.corp
ZORIX_LOG_LEVEL=info
ZORIX_TENANT=druix

Action item (Quarrel MQ outage, severity 2): log compaction stalled on partition leaders when segment count exceeded the open-file budget, blocking consumer offsets. Fix: raise the file-descriptor ceiling in the Bramblewick deploy profile and add a compaction-lag alert at 30 minutes. Owner: queue platform team, due next sprint. Compaction tuning parameters and the alert definition are on the internal page below.

wiki page, hahif-hahif: https://argocd.kelvisys.corp/browse/board/settings/pages/1442e0b1065d83f1